Us
With you I feel my heart,
As love began to start.
The two of us shall grow,
Let's take things very slow.
The first moment we met,
I haven't known it yet,
That this is love that I felt,
Until my heart begins to melt.
The time froze like ice,
As I gaze to your pretty eyes.
Truly lovely sight it is,
Your stare to me can move trees.
You have a gorgeous hair,
Also mine, to be fair.
